The geography of Colombia is defined by the Andes Mountains, which split into three major cordilleras: Western, Central, and Eastern. This topography creates some of the most challenging transport routes in the world. Key logistical channels, such as the mountain pass of La Línea linking Bogotá and Buenaventura, expose commercial vehicles to steep, sustained downhill gradients. For heavy-duty fleets operating under these extreme conditions, drum brakes remain the bedrock of safety. Specifically, the demand for high-performance brake shoes with lining is paramount.
In Colombia, the fleet consists of various European, American, and increasingly dominant Chinese heavy commercial vehicles. Due to the high-load operations, long downhill routes, and varying temperature ranges (from tropical sea-level zones like Barranquilla to high-altitude mountain environments like Bogotá at 2,600m), brake wear is accelerated. Fleet operators face high maintenance costs if they choose low-quality lining materials. This has pushed Colombian procurement managers to seek premium, durable, and certified brake assemblies that deliver stability, thermal capacity, and structural integrity.
For heavy transport in the Andes, friction material design is a critical safety consideration. Standard materials glaze under high heat, leading to brake fade—a reduction in braking force that can cause accidents. The transition away from asbestos in accordance with Colombia's Ley 1968 de 2019 has shifted the focus to advanced non-asbestos organic (NAO), semi-metallic, and low-steel formulations.

Brake shoes imported into Colombia must satisfy rigorous safety and environmental requirements. Chief among these is the submission of the **Certificado de Conformidad (Certificate of Conformity)**, proving the products meet either ECE R90 standards or the United States' FMVSS 121 criteria. The Ministry of Commerce, Industry, and Tourism (MINCIT) checks imports to ensure that zero asbestos content is present, inline with National Law 1968 of 2019. Testing documents must verify friction stability under load, structural shear strength, and the composition of the lining.
**Semi-metallic linings** contain higher metal densities (steel, copper, or iron fibers), which offer excellent thermal conductivity. When traversing steep decents, these linings transfer heat away from the friction interface, helping prevent brake fade. **Low-metallic linings** use a higher ratio of organic fibers combined with less steel, providing quiet operation and good cold friction performance. For heavy-duty fleets operating on steep gradients, semi-metallic linings are preferred for their heat dissipation capabilities and structural integrity under prolonged thermal stress.
Ley 1968 of 2019 prohibits the exploitation, production, commercialization, and import of any products containing asbestos. As a result, Chinese manufacturers supply **100% Non-Asbestos Organic (NAO)** or semi-metallic formulations. Import consignments must be clearly documented with material safety data sheets (MSDS) and testing reports certifying 0% asbestos content. This ensures smooth clearance at ports such as Buenaventura and Cartagena.
The service life of brake components depends on vehicle load, road terrain, and driver behavior. Under normal conditions on highway logistics routes, premium semi-metallic linings typically last between **80,000 km and 100,000 km**. However, for dump trucks operating in mining regions or along steep Andean corridors, service life can decrease to **40,000 km to 60,000 km** due to heavy brake applications and grit exposure. Using linings with wear indicators can help prevent drum wear by signaling when replacements are needed.
Brake glazing occurs when friction material is subjected to temperatures beyond its design limit. Under these conditions, organic binders in the lining melt and form a smooth, glass-like surface that reduces stopping power. To prevent glazing: 1. Ensure drivers use engine compression brakes (retarders) to control descent speeds. 2. Install linings formulated with high-quality resins and thermal-stabilizing metals that withstand temperatures up to **400°C** without breaking down. 3. Check drum-to-lining contact margins to avoid uneven pressure spots.
When a fully loaded dump truck brakes on a steep incline, extreme shear forces are generated at the interface between the friction lining and the steel shoe. If the shear strength is insufficient, the lining can shear off the shoe, resulting in immediate brake failure. High-quality brake shoes must exceed a **shear strength limit of 1.5 MPa** (as tested by Link/Chase equipment). This structural reliability is achieved through heavy-duty steel riveting and high-temperature curing adhesives.

**Riveted linings** utilize high-tensile brass or aluminum rivets to secure the friction material to the cast or stamped steel shoe. They are highly resistant to thermal expansion stresses and are easier to replace in typical workshop environments. **Bonded linings** use high-performance adhesive cured under heat. This provides a continuous surface area and eliminates the risk of scoring the brake drum with exposed rivet heads as the lining wears down. For heavy commercial vehicles in Colombia, a combination of bonding and riveting is often used for maximum safety.
Drum brake linings are equipped with visual wear indicators or grooves cut into the friction block. During inspection, mechanics check these indicators through the dust shield viewing ports. If the lining thickness has worn down to the bottom of the indicator groove, or measures less than **6mm** (on heavy truck shoes), it is time to replace the lining to protect the brake drum from damage.
